An unmet medical need exists for therapeutic regimens in transplantation that allow immediate postoperative graft function, thereby improving graft survival. Delayed graft function (DGF) after transplantation is the most common complication affecting kidney allographs in the immediate transplant period. The specific aim of this study is to evaluate the effect of recombinant human C1-inhibitor (rhC1INH), as a kidney recipient intra- and post operative treatment strategy to decrease systemic inflammation and decrease the incidence of DGF from donation after cardiac death donors (DCD).
Full description
This is a randomized, single-center double blinded study.
The main objective of this study are to determine the ability of rhC1INH to reduce the incidence and severity of delayed graft function in comparison to placebo in recipients of kidneys after cardio-circulatory determination of death (DCD).
This trial has specifically been designed to evaluate the protective effect of rhC1INH treatment in patients at high risk of developing DGF. The selection of potential donors to be part of this study will be limited to the population of DCD donors which have historically shown a risk of developing DGF ranging between 40-55%. Participation in each group will be randomly assigned. Treatment will be administered by an intra-operative infusion of placebo or rhC1INH (100 Units/kg) IV followed by twice a day infusion of 50 Units/Kg IV for the following 48 hours.
A total of 20 subjects will be divided into 2 groups:
Group 1: Control group: standard recipient management + placebo (0.9% Sodium Chloride IV to equal volume of investigational arm: intraoperatively, and then every 12 hours x 2 = total of 3 doses). treatment (n=10) Group 2: Standard recipient management + 100 U/kg intraoperative followed by 50 U/kg every 12 hours x 2 = total of 3 doses (200 U/kg).
Max dose 8400 units for the initial dose and 4200 units maximum for the second and third doses.

Inclusion and exclusion criteria
Inclusion Criteria for Transplant Recipient:
Adult patients receiving a transplanted kidney should satisfy the following to be considered part of the study:
Has the ability to understand the requirements of the study, is able to provide written informed consent (including consent for the use and disclosure of research related health information).
Male or female at least 18 years of age.
Is to be a recipient of a transplant from a deceased donor (donation after cardio-circulatory determination of death criteria).
Is able to comply with standard of care induction therapy requirement, such as antibody induction therapy with rabbit polyclonal anti-thymocyte globulin,anti-CD25 (anti-IL2R), or Anti-CD52.
A female subject is eligible to enter the study if she is:
Male subjects with female partners of childbearing potential must agree to use an effective means of contraception (per the site-specific guidelines or use 2 methods of birth control concurrently, whichever is more stringent), which will be continued until the Day 180 visit. They will also agree not to donate sperm until 6 months after dosing.
Must be up-to-date on cancer screening according to site-specific guidelines and past medical history must be negative for biopsy-confirmed malignancy within 5 years of randomization, with the exception of adequately treated basal cell or squamous cell carcinoma in situ or carcinoma of the cervix in situ.
Must be willing to comply with the protocol procedures for the duration of the study, including scheduled follow-up visits and examinations.
